How To Choose The Best Affordable CPU Cooler

The wrong cooler can leave you thermal-throttling during a critical render or game. Focus on a few key specs that define real-world performance.

Heatpipe Count and Configuration

Heatpipes are the highways for heat moving from your CPU to the fin stack. Four pipes are the minimum for decent mid-range cooling, while six or seven pipes in a dual-tower design handle high-TDP processors. Direct-contact pipes perform well but a soldered copper base improves heat transfer evenly across the surface.

TDP Rating and Socket Compatibility

Every cooler lists a TDP (Thermal Design Power) rating. Match or exceed your CPU’s TDP for adequate cooling. Socket support is non-negotiable — ensure the cooler includes brackets for your specific Intel or AMD socket, especially LGA1700 and AM5 which require updated mounting hardware.

Fan Noise and Airflow

Noise levels measured in dBA at max RPM tell only part of the story. A 25 dBA rating is whisper-quiet, while anything above 32 dBA becomes noticeable without a case. Consider fans with PWM control for automatic speed adjustment based on CPU temperature — this keeps noise low during idle and ramps up only when needed.

Physical Clearance

Case width determines the maximum cooler height. Dual-tower coolers like the Montech NX600 require around 160mm of clearance while shorter single-towers fit most mid-tower cases. RAM clearance is equally critical — some coolers overhang memory slots, blocking tall heatspreaders.

FAQ

Will a dual-tower cooler fit in my mid-tower case?
Measure your case’s maximum CPU cooler height — this is usually listed in the specs. Most mid-tower cases accommodate coolers up to 160mm tall. The Montech NX600 and ID-COOLING FROZN A620 PRO SE are around 157mm and fit most cases. Always double-check clearance before purchasing.
How does direct-contact heatpipe technology compare to a soldered copper base?
Direct-contact heatpipes are cheaper and work well for mid-range chips, but small gaps between pipes can reduce thermal transfer. A soldered copper base provides a flat, continuous surface that distributes heat evenly, improving performance on high-TDP processors. The Montech NX600 uses a soldered base for better efficiency.
